Output 44975dddcdfd59c186353354ae8cc7bc53801c52923b685b3d9774baf36c49f5:0

value
652120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2cf4a72a6b78aebf4404ac9d81a0ff08b3c41b OP_EQUAL
address
3PDoFPd3wa2Y9K6Ncf8nedmkFkF4c1RpZa
transaction
44975dddcdfd59c186353354ae8cc7bc53801c52923b685b3d9774baf36c49f5
spent
true